为了账号安全,请及时绑定邮箱和手机立即绑定

python关于换行打印的问题,请大哥们支个招!

python关于换行打印的问题,请大哥们支个招!

宝慕林4294392 2018-07-17 12:05:19
程序如下:for i in range(1,5):    for x in range(1,5):        print("%d %d\t" % (i,x))1 1 1 2 1 3 1 4 2 1 2 2 2 3 2 4 3 1 3 2 3 3 3 4 4 1 4 2 4 3 4 4   #打印的结果如何换行打印变成如下的结果11 12 13 1421 22 23 2431 32 33 3441 42 43 44
查看完整描述

2 回答

?
慕莱坞森

TA贡献1810条经验 获得超4个赞

python3以上的话,这样


for i in range(1,5):        
    for x in range(1,5):
            print("%d %d\t" % (i,x), end="")
    print("")


查看完整回答
反对 回复 2018-07-18
?
万千封印

TA贡献1891条经验 获得超3个赞

for i in range(1,5):    
    print '\t'.join([("%d %d" %( i,x ) )for x in range(1,5)])


查看完整回答
反对 回复 2018-07-18
  • 2 回答
  • 0 关注
  • 458 浏览

添加回答

举报

0/150
提交
取消
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号